Jay Kirk

Jay Kirk is an American journalist, author, and lecturer at the University of Pennsylvania. He was born on July 19, 1970, and has written for publications such as GQ, New York Times Magazine, and Harper's. His book ''Kingdom Under Glass'', published in 2010, recounts the life and story of taxidermist Carl Akeley. He is the recipient of a 2017 Whiting Foundation Creative Nonfiction Grant for his upcoming book ''Avoid the Day''. Kirk is a National Magazine Award finalist for his story ''Burning Man'', received the 2005 Pew Fellowship in the Arts and also is a MacDowell Fellow.
